  • Patent number: 3989144
    Abstract: This invention relates to an apparatus for transferring a mold from a centrifugal compacting device to the next place in the process of manufacturing a concrete pole or pile, by using many jacks to raise a mold from on the centrifugal compacting device for the transferring operation to rails on which the mold is put to be transferred to the next place.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: November 14, 1974
    Date of Patent: November 2, 1976
    Assignee: Nippon Concrete Industries Co. Ltd.
    Inventors: Kenzo Momota, Koji Nunokawa, Yoshihiro Toyoda
  • Patent number: 3966375
    Abstract: This invention relates to an apparatus for manufacturing concrete poles which has a train system running on a rail and stays on a required place to manufacture concrete poles, and is characterized in comprising at least a wire storage device, a caging stand, a mold traverser, a spinning machine and a device for carrying materials or products.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: July 30, 1974
    Date of Patent: June 29, 1976
    Assignee: Nippon Concrete Industries, Co., Ltd.
    Inventors: Yoshikiyo Fukushima, Kenzo Momota, Hideaki Shirahata, Noriyuki Sakanai
